Anyway, in what order does one need to adhere to when purchasing/installing skid plates? I know that some bolt on top of others, if I got my memory straight.

The Tank and Transfer Case are Stand Alone, Thhe Transmission one installs then the Engine One goes over that where they meet. If you get the Radiator Skid Plate that also needs to be install with The Engine Plate. Let me know if this doesnt make sense

Part Number: 52125385AB

You will need 2X 06506644AA(Rivet) and 4X 06104416AA(Bolt and Washer)

I know this is an old post, but do you need to remove front bumper for the radiator plate, or is it just bolt on with the parts listed above?

No need to remove the front bumper to install the radiator skin. It bolts to the front crossmember using nutzerts (IIRC) and to the front of the engine skid.

I ordered accessory kits for the other skid plates, and so the skids came with bolts and nutzerts and a tool that you could use to install (squish) the nutzerts into the frame rails by turning a bolt with a ratchet.

The radiator skid was a replacement part not an accessory kit so i had to get nutzerts and bolts for it separately.
